DLSS - Download and Get Started (2024)

Getting Started with DLSS


  • Download DLSS Frame Generation SDK
  • System Requirements
  • Release Notes
  • FAQ

  • Download DLSS Super Resolution SDK
  • System Requirements
  • Release Notes

  • Download DLSS Unreal Engine Plugin
  • System Requirements
  • Release Notes
  • FAQ

  • Download DLSS Unity Plugin
  • System Requirements
  • Release Notes

  • Resources
  • NVIDIA Developer Program
  • Contact Us

NVIDIA DLSS

DLSS is a suite of AI rendering technologies powered by Tensor Cores on GeForce RTX GPUs for faster frame rates, better image quality, and great responsiveness. DLSS now includes Super Resolution & DLAA (available for all RTX GPUs), Frame Generation (RTX 40 Series GPUs), and Ray Reconstruction (available for all RTX GPUs). To get the full benefits of DLSS, download both DLSS Super Resolution and DLSS Frame Generation SDKs/Plugins.

DLSS Ray Reconstruction
(Coming Soon)

DLSS Ray Reconstruction, which enhances image quality by using AI to generate additional pixels for intensive ray-traced scenes, will be coming soon to DLSS 3.5. Please contact your NVIDIA account manager for early access to Ray Reconstruction, or sign up to be notified when it’s publicly available here: https://developer.nvidia.com/rtx/dlss/notify-me

Download DLSS Frame Generation

System Requirements


Streamline Plugin 2.4.10
Operating Systems Win10 20H1 (version 2004 - 10.0.19041) or newer
Dependencies Install the latest graphics driver. If using NVIDIA GPU, it must be 522.25 or newer.
Development Environment VS Code or VS2017/VS2019 with SDK 10.0.19041+
Engine Requirements DirectX 12

Release Notes


Streamline Plugin NVIDIA DLSS 3.7.10 SDK is now available through Streamline SDK 2.4.10
  • Bug Fixes and Improvements

*Streamline is an open-sourced cross-IHV solution that simplifies integration of the latest NVIDIA and other independent hardware vendors’ super resolution technologies into applications and games.

I Agree To the Terms of the NVIDIA DLSS End User License Agreement



FAQ

Q: What is the difference between DLSS Super Resolution, Frame Generation, and Ray Reconstruction?

A: DLSS Super Resolution uses AI to reconstruct images comparable or better than native resolution. DLSS Frame generation was introduced with Ada (RTX 40 Series GPUs) and uses AI to analyze sequential frames and motion data to create additional high quality, responsive frames. DLSS Ray Reconstruction replaces hand-tuned denoisers with an NVIDIA Supercomputer-trained AI network that generates higher quality pixels in between sampled rays.


Q: What do I get in the DLSS 3.7.0 SDK?

A: The SDK includes an integration guide, sample code and a sample application.


A: Any GeForce RTX GPU can support DLSS Ray Reconstruction and DLSS Super Resolution as they feature the required Tensor Cores. DLSS Frame Generation requires a RTX 40 Series GPU.


Q: What APIs are supported?

A: DLSS Ray Reconstruction is supported on DX12 and Vulkan (beta).



Download DLSS Super Resolution

System Requirements


SDK v3.7.10
Streamline Plugin 2.4.10
Operating Systems Windows 10 64-bit
DirectX End-User Runtimes (June 2010)
Linux kernel, 2.6.32 and newer
Win10 20H1 (version 2004 - 10.0.19041) or newer
Dependencies NVIDIA RTX GPU
NVIDIA DLSS SDK requires 471.11 driver or newer.
Install the latest graphics driver. If using NVIDIA GPU, it MUST be 522.25 or newer.
Development Environment Visual Studio 2017 v15.6 or later
Linux SDK: glibc 2.11 or newer
Linux SDK Sample Code: gcc and g++ 8.4.0 or newer
VS Code or VS2017/VS2019 with SDK 10.0.19041+
Engine Requirements
  • DirectX 11, DirectX 12, or Vulkan based
  • Additional note for Vulkan: The Vulkan path of DLSS expects the application to run on a Vulkan version 1.1 or later.

  • On each evaluate call (i.e. each frame), provide:
  • The raw color buffer for the frame (in HDR or LDR/SDR space).
  • Screen space motion vectors that are: accurate and calculated at 16 or 32 bits per-pixel; and updated each frame.
  • The depth buffer for the frame.
  • The exposure value (if processing in HDR space).

DirectX 11/DirectX 12

Release Notes


DLSS Super Resolution SDK NVIDIA DLSS SDK 3.7.10 is now available for download for all developers.
  • Bug Fixes and Improvements
Streamline Plugin DLSS Super Resolution 3.7.10 is now available for Streamline SDK 2.4.10

*Streamline is an open-sourced cross-IHV solution that simplifies integration of the latest NVIDIA and other independent hardware vendors’ super resolution technologies into applications and games.

I Agree To the Terms of the NVIDIA DLSS End User License Agreement



Download DLSS 3.7.10 Unreal Engine

System Requirements


Operating Systems Windows 10 64-bit
DirectX End-User Runtimes (June 2010)
Dependencies NVIDIA RTX GPU
NVIDIA DLSS Plugin recommends 536.99 driver or newer.
DX12 (required for Frame Generation Features), DX11, Vulkan
Engine Support Unreal Engine 5.4, 5.3, 5.2, 5.1, 5.0 & 4.27


NVIDIA DLSS 3.7.10 for Unreal Engine contains DLSS Super Resolution & Frame Generation Plugins. Download the NVIDIA DLSS 3.7.10 Unreal Engine package below to get access to all plugins.


DLSS 3.7.10 Package Features include:

  • DLSS Frame Generation
  • DLSS Super Resolution
  • NVIDIA Reflex
  • DLAA
  • NVIDIA Image Scaling
  • RTX Dynamic Vibrance

PLEASE NOTE: The DLSS 3.7.10 Plugins supports all DLSS technologies for Unreal Engine 5.4, 5.3, & 5.2 out of the box. To use DLSS 3.7 plugin with previous engine versions, click your UE version below for step-by-step instructions for source access.


I Agree To the Terms of the NVIDIA DLSS End User License Agreement



FAQ

Q: My DLSS Plugin is enabled in Unreal Engine 5.0 (or prior), but I’m not seeing the dropdown menu tool, how do I fix this?

A: There are multiple items that can cause the DLSS dropdown menu tool to not be visible. To ensure your machine and project are both fully supported, please verify that the following guidelines are met.

  1. You have a project using UE 5.0 or prior.
  2. Minimum Driver version of 531.68 is installed on your machine. You can download and install the latest version either directly through GeForce Experience or simply download and install the driver from https://www.nvidia.com/drivers.
  3. Ensure you’re using the corresponding plugin version for the engine you’re running. Please follow the Getting Started with DLSS guide for further instructions on how to install.
  4. The "Enable DLSS to be turned on in Editor viewports" checkbox is marked in your project settings under "Plugins - NVIDIA DLSS".
  5. Your editor viewport is set to Perspective and Lit modes. DLSS Plugin does not support the other viewport modes.
  6. The DLSS Plugin is not compatible with the RenderDoc Plugin. Please be sure to check if you have the RenderDoc Plugin enabled in your project’s Plugins settings. If it is enabled, please disable and restart the engine.

DLSS support can be verified by searching in the UE5 and EU4 log files for “LogDLSS: NVIDIA NGX DLSS supported 1” and related messages. If you still do not see the dropdown menu tool, please email us at DLSS-Support@nvidia.com.


Q: Can anyone use the NVIDIA DLSS Plugin?

A: Yes! NVIDIA DLSS 3.7 binary compatibility is available for Unreal Engine 5.2 and later. Source code is available for Unreal Engine 4.27, 5.0, and 5.1.


Q: Where do I go to get access to DLSS Ray Reconstruction?

A: Please contact your NVIDIA account manager for early access to Ray Reconstruction, or sign up to be notified when it’s publicly available here: https://developer.nvidia.com/rtx/dlss/notify-me.


Q: Where do I get source access to DLSS 3.7?

A: Source code to the DLSS SDK is at https://github.com/NVIDIA/DLSS


Q: Why doesn’t the Cinematic Camera DOF work with DLSS?

A: DLSS workload occurs in the same spot as TAAU in the pipeline. Due to this, DOF does not play well with upscalers. Epic has provided additional information regarding this here.


Q: How can I use NVIDIA DLSS with other upscaling technologies for cross platform support?

DLSS workload occurs at the same point as other upscaling technologies in the render pipeline. This is an implementation requirement in Unreal Engine. Due to this, only one upscaling technology can be "enabled" (loaded) at a time. This keeps the NVIDIA DLSS plugin enabled but also avoids potential incompatibilities by skipping the driver side NGX parts of DLSS.


Q: Why am I getting unexpected results in my PostProcessingmaterials with DLSS?

A: DLSS workload occurs in the same spot as TAAU in the pipeline. Due to this, post processing material differences can occur. Please refer to the “View Size and Render Target Size” and “Post Process Material after Temporal Upsample” sections of Unreal Engine documentation for more details.


Q: Is VR Supported?

A: The DLSS Super Resolution Plugin is not compatible with VR Supported Unreal Engine Apps at this time.


Q: Is Movie Render Queue (MRQ) Supported?

A: Yes, it’s supported


Q: I see ghosting on dynamic geometry. Are there any engine settings related to that?

A: DLSS requires correct motion vectors to function properly. The r.BasePassForceOutputsVelocity console variable can be used to render motion vectors for all objects, and not just the ones with dynamic geometry. This can be useful if it's infeasible to e.g. change all meshes to stationary or dynamic.


Q: Why am I not seeing NVIDIA DLSS Frame Generation working in Play In Editor (viewport and standalone viewport) mode(s)?

A: NVIDIA DLSS Frame Generation offers various support for modes:

  • Selected Viewport (main Editor window)
    • DLSS Frame Generation is not supported
    • Blueprint logic reports FG as supported which is helpful when developing UI + Blueprint, however enabling FG will not actually run it
  • New Editor Windows - Play In Editor (PIE)
    • DLSS Frame Generation is partially supported
    • Possibly with reduced image quality since some of the additional input buffers to DLSS Frame Generation are not available in this PIE mode.
    • Blueprint logic reports Frame Generation as supported which is helpful to develop UI + Blueprints
  • Standalone Game
    • DLSS Frame Generation is supported
    • Same support as a packaged build

Q: If I want to report an issue to NVIDIA, who do I report to and what information should I send?

A: Please report your findings by emailing the NVIDIA DLSS Support Team at DLSS-Support@nvidia.com. When sending your report, please also attach the *.log files from <YourProject>\Saved\Logs so we may better assist you.




Download the Unity Plugin

System Requirements


Unity DLSS Super Resolution Plugin
Operating Systems Windows 10 64-bit
DirectX End-User Runtimes (June 2010)
Dependencies NVIDIA RTX GPU
NVIDIA DLSS plugin requires 471.11 driver or newer
Development Environment Visual Studio 2017 v15.6 or later
Engine Support Unity 2021.2 Beta versions or newer
High Definition Render Pipeline (HDRP) Compatible Only


Unity Plugin


NVIDIA DLSS Super Resolution is now available through Unity 2021.2 Beta versions or newer.





NVIDIA Developer Program


Access all the tools and training critical to accelerating applications on NVIDIA technology platforms.


Join today Visit theNVIDIA DeveloperForums



Contact Us


For inquiries regarding the plugin or for general support, please reach out to us via our support alias.


Email support alias

DLSS - Download and Get Started (2024)

FAQs

Does DLSS turn on automatically? ›

Unfortunately, you don't automatically get the benefits of DLSS with most games. Instead, you must enable DLSS in each game through its settings menu. First, launch a game that supports DLSS. Open the Settings menu and go to the Graphics tab.

Should I enable DLSS in games? ›

DLSS is beneficial for both high-end gaming PCs and mid-range systems. While DLSS can provide significant performance improvements on high-resolution displays, even users with mid-range systems can benefit from DLSS by enabling higher graphical settings or achieving smoother gameplay at lower resolutions.

Why is DLSS not working? ›

You're probably CPU bottlenecked so DLSS can't help. I had this issue. Revalidated the game but DLSS was still missing from the options and I only Default and FSR. I then revalidated the game and Steam redownloaded the missing files and DLSS was working again.

Can you turn on DLSS without ray tracing? ›

NVIDIA DLSS is available for both DirectX 11 and DirectX 12 in The Medium, can be used with or without ray tracing, and has three presets: High, which equates to 'DLSS Quality', is recommended for 1920x1080; Medium, which equates to 'DLSS Balanced', is recommended for 2560x1440; Low, which equates to 'DLSS Performance' ...

Do I have to manually update DLSS? ›

The DLSS the game ships with is an old version. Manually update your DLSS file to the latest version to get improved quality, less ghosting, less noise and sometimes even better performance! This is only for Nvidia GPUs in 2000-3000 and 4000 series.

Does DLSS update automatically? ›

Developers can now automatically update to the latest DLSS AI networks. You can patch your games over the air (OTA) using the NVIDIA Game Ready Drivers with the latest DLSS improvements. Gamers can also automatically and seamlessly enjoy these latest DLSS enhancements.

What GPU is DLSS available? ›

Architecture. With the exception of the shader-core version implemented in Control, DLSS is only available on GeForce RTX 20, GeForce RTX 30, GeForce RTX 40, and Quadro RTX series of video cards, using dedicated AI accelerators called Tensor Cores.

Do you lose FPS with DLSS? ›

In a word, absolutely. With NVIDIA DLSS, gamers aren't tethered to native 4K hoping to achieve 50-60 fps.

What DLSS settings to use? ›

The three core modes of DLSS are Quality, Balanced, and Performance. The Ultra Performance mode is optional, so you may not see it in every DLSS game. You're safe with the core three modes. Naturally, Balanced looks better than Performance, and Quality looks the best, but all three modes are usable.

Does NVIDIA DLSS work on every game? ›

No, not all games currently support NVIDIA® DLSS. However, the list of supported games is continuously growing as more developers integrate DLSS into their titles.

What is the downside to DLSS? ›

But it's not all good news. Hardware and game support are an obvious problem for DLSS. It's only supported on recent Nvidia graphics cards, and DLSS 3 requires the newest Nvidia RTX 40-series hardware. Game support is limited, too.

How to activate DLSS? ›

DLSS Frame Generation - how to enable Hardware-Accelerated GPU scheduling
  1. Press Windows key on your keyboard and type "graphics" and press enter. - Graphics settings menu should open.
  2. In the Graphics settings menu toggle the "Hardware-accelerated GPU scheduling" option.
  3. Restart your PC.

Does turning on DLSS increase FPS? ›

However, when you enable DLSS in balanced mode, the frame rate doubles to 89 fps. That means you get all the fancy eye candy that the Ray Tracing Overdrive update brings, but at a fast frame rate, and that's before Frame Generation, new with Nvidia RTX 4000 cards, enters the picture.

How do I enable RTX mode? ›

1. In your NVIDIA Control Panel, under Adjust Video Image Settings -> RTX Video Enhancements, enable Super Resolution or HDR. 2. Windows “Graphics settings”: Under Custom options for apps, add the path to your Chrome or Edge browser.

How do DLSS settings work? ›

It improves game performance by rendering games at a resolution below a display's native resolution, then using AI to upscale the result. Cyberpunk 2077 is an ideal example. If you select 4K resolution and choose DLSS Quality mode, the game will render at 1440p resolution. DLSS upscales the result to 4K.

How to activate DLSS in Fortnite? ›

Scroll down the Video Settings menu. Change “DirectX Version” to “DirectX 12”, if not already enabled, restart the game, then return to the Video Settings menu. Select a “DLSS” mode - Performance is recommended for 4K, Balanced for 2560x1440, and Quality for 1920x1080.

What does DLSS run on? ›

Architecture. With the exception of the shader-core version implemented in Control, DLSS is only available on GeForce RTX 20, GeForce RTX 30, GeForce RTX 40, and Quadro RTX series of video cards, using dedicated AI accelerators called Tensor Cores.

Top Articles
Now is the Best Time! Our 2024 Florida Road Trip (update 7/27)
31 Best Stops Between Mali Losinj and Rijeka
Pau.blaz
Orange County's diverse vegan Mexican food movement gains momentum
Tinyzonehd
Lovex Load Data | xxlreloading.com
Best NBA 2K23 Builds for Every Position
Optum Primary Care - Winter Park Aloma
Rent A Center Entertainment Center
Craigslist Shallotte
Websites erstellen, benennen, kopieren oder löschen
Almost Home Natchitoches Menu
When His Eyes Opened Chapter 3096
Wausau Pilot Obituaries
Amazing Lash Bay Colony
Busted Newspaper Hampton County VA Mugshots
Milanka Kudel Telegram
Swissport Timecard
102Km To Mph
Zillow Group, Inc. Aktie (A14NX6) - Kurs Nasdaq - MarketScreener
Dumb Money, la recensione: Paul Dano e quel film biografico sul caso GameStop
2013 Freightliner Cascadia Fuse Box Diagram
Urbfsdreamgirl
Susan Bowers Facebook
I Wanna Dance With Somebody Showtimes Near St. Landry Cinema
Lox Club Gift Code
How 'Tuesday' Brings Death to Life With Heart, Humor, and a Giant Bird
Craigslist Free Charlottesville Va
Bollywood Movies 123Movies
Realidades 2 Capitulo 2B Answers
Shellys Earth Materials
Coverwood Terriers For Sale
Craigs List Skagit County
Bully Scholarship Edition Math 5
How To Get Stone Can In Merge Mansion 2022
Ticket To Paradise Showtimes Near Laemmle Newhall
Seattle Rpz
Huskersillustrated Husker Board
Opsb Pay Dates
Danville Va Active Warrant List
Carabao Cup Wiki
Son Blackmailing Mother
Clarksburg Wv Craigslist Personals
Bfri Forum
Jcp Meevo Com
Left Periprosthetic Femur Fracture Icd 10
Riscap Attorney Registration
Alle Eurovision Song Contest Videos
The Crew 2 Cheats für PS4, Xbox One und PC ▷➡️
Hollyday Med Spa Prairie Village
304-733-7788
Imagetrend Elite Delaware
Latest Posts
Article information

Author: Golda Nolan II

Last Updated:

Views: 6261

Rating: 4.8 / 5 (58 voted)

Reviews: 81% of readers found this page helpful

Author information

Name: Golda Nolan II

Birthday: 1998-05-14

Address: Suite 369 9754 Roberts Pines, West Benitaburgh, NM 69180-7958

Phone: +522993866487

Job: Sales Executive

Hobby: Worldbuilding, Shopping, Quilting, Cooking, Homebrewing, Leather crafting, Pet

Introduction: My name is Golda Nolan II, I am a thoughtful, clever, cute, jolly, brave, powerful, splendid person who loves writing and wants to share my knowledge and understanding with you.